Quote margin is the profit left over after a stamping job's fully-loaded cost is subtracted from the price you quote, shown in both dollars and as a percentage. Estimators and sales engineers on press lines use it to sanity-check a bid before it goes out, since a job that looks busy but quotes thin can lose money once die maintenance, scrap, and secondary ops are counted. The math is straightforward — price minus cost, over a revenue basis — but it forces you to load every real cost into the denominator before you commit a number. On repeat automotive and appliance work with pennies of margin per part, getting this right at quote time is the difference between a profitable program and a break-even one.

How to use the result

  • Use it while building or reviewing a stamping quote, before the price is committed to the customer.
  • It is only as honest as the cost you feed it — leave out die maintenance, scrap allowance, or secondary ops and the margin will look better than the job actually is.

Common questions

  • How do you calculate quote margin? Subtract fully-loaded cost from quoted price for dollar margin, then divide by your revenue basis for margin percent. At $125 price, $100 cost and a $100 basis, margin is $25 and 25%.
  • What is a good margin on a stamping quote? High-volume automotive stamping often runs single-digit to low-teens gross margin, while low-volume or complex progressive-die work can support 20-30%+. The 25% in the example is healthy for a job that carries real engineering or tooling risk.
  • Should margin be over price or over cost? This tool divides by whatever revenue basis you enter. Dividing margin by price gives gross margin; dividing by cost gives markup. Be clear which you are reporting — 25% margin on price is a bigger absolute dollar figure than 25% markup on cost.
  • What costs belong in the fully-loaded cost? Material, blanking and forming press time, die maintenance amortization, scrap and rework allowance, secondary ops, and packaging. Anything you would spend to ship the part should be in the $100 cost, not left out.
  • Why does the revenue basis matter? It sets what the percentage is measured against. In the example the basis equals cost ($100), so 25% is a markup on cost. Switch the basis to the $125 price and the same $25 becomes a 20% gross margin.
